Banner Health and the Faculty team at North Colorado Family Medicine (NCFM) are pleased to announce an opening for a Board Eligible or Board Certified Pediatrician to join their fully accredited program in Greeley, Colorado.
Training Resident physicians since 1974, NCFM is a community-based, unopposed residency program providing resident physicians with unparalleled, full-spectrum training opportunities. NCFM’s graduates are able to take advantage of this training which prepares them for practice in any setting, particularly under-resourced areas. About 60% of NCFM graduates locate in rural areas, with 70% continuing to provide inpatient pediatrics as part of their practice.

NCFM is affiliated with North Colorado Medical Center (NCMC) a Level II Trauma (ACS Trauma Verification) regional tertiary medical center serving patients from a four-state region (northeastern Colorado, western Nebraska, southeastern Wyoming, and western Kansas) and includes a Level III Nursery and a full complement of sub-specialties, 24-hour 16-bed ICU with EICU support, a state-of-the-art hybrid OR w/IVUS, and rapid response teams. NCMC provides air medical transport (North Colorado Med EVac) in northern Colorado. NCMC has been named among the nation’s 100 Top Hospitals® by Truven Health Analytics™ and one of America’s 50 Best Hospitals Award™ as measured by Healthgrades. This distinction places NCMC among the top 1 percent of all hospitals in the nation.
